Foundation Overview

Based in Dover, NH, Taylor-smith Foundation has awarded 7 grants totaling $56,688 to organizations in Ohio, Pennsylvania and 1 other state across the US. Individual grants range from $3,000 to $33,188, with a median award of $4,500.

Grants & Funding

Analyzing past grantees provides valuable insights into Taylor-smith Foundation's funding preferences, organizational priorities, and grant making patterns. This historical data helps potential applicants understand the foundation's strategic focus and identify successful funding approaches.

Name Amount Location Purpose Year
Fidelity Charitable - Giving Account $33,188 Cincinnati, OH, US Transfer Of Cash Into Donor Advised Fund 2017
Denison University $4,500 Granville, OH, US Scholarship Fund 2016
Lorain County Community College $5,000 Elyria, OH, US Scholarship Fund 2016
Sisters Of The Humility Of Mary $3,000 Villa Maria, PA, US General Needs 2016
St Mary Church $3,000 Lorain, OH, US General Needs 2016
Thomas Moore College $3,000 Crestview Hills, KY, US Scholarship Fund 2016
University Of Dayton $5,000 Dayton, OH, US Scholarship Fund 2016

Form 990-PF Research Tips
  •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
  •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
  •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
  •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
